WHERE WE'RE AT: SIUE women's soccer enters Sunday's contest looking ton continue an impressive run of offensive form, having netted four goals in their OVC opener at Tennessee Tech last Sunday.
LAST TIME OUT: The Cougars opened up Ohio Valley Conference play with a strong performance, netting four goals en route to an overtime victory at Tennessee Tech last Sunday.
MacKenzie Litzsinger stole the show, netting a pair of goals and an assist in the win. One of those goals included the game winner just 59 seconds into the first overtime period. Her efforts secured her sixth OVC Offensive Player of the Week award and second award of the young season.
SCOUTING THE EAGLES: Morehead State comes to Edwardsville with a 3-5-3 record and a 1-0-1 record in OVC play. The Eagles are coming off a 1-0 home win over Tennessee Tech on Thursday and started off the OVC campaign with a 1-1 draw at Eastern Illinois. The Eagles finished last spring with a 2-8 mark, including a 1-0 loss to the Cougars (Mar. 19). Morehead State was picked to finish last in the OVC and is led by Preseason OVC Player to Watch Michelle Jerantowski.
LOCAL FLAIR: Coach Burton has recruited and retained talented student-
athletes from throughout the Metro East and Greater St. Louis regions. Of the 33 student-athletes on this season's roster, 21 hail from Greater St. Louis - this includes five who came to SIUE from a county in the Metro East region.
RETURNERS: The Cougars return all but two starters from last season's OVC champion squad, and bring back all three goalkeepers from Spring 2021. Highlighting the returning Cougars are OVC Forward of the Year
MacKenzie Litzsinger, All-OVC and United Soccer Coaches All-South Region Second Team selection
Lily Schnieders, and OVC All-Newcomer selection
Matea Diekema.
NEW FACES: The Red & White welcome eight newcomers to the program, six of whom hail from the Greater St. Louis area. Included in this class are sisters Ashlyn and
Kaitlyn Nichols (O'Fallon, Mo.), who join Matea and
Myah Diekema as the only known pair of sisters playing in the same Division I soccer program.
